The Scenario
In this scenario, we are focusing on a tropical coral reef that is facing some serious challenges. You might notice that the coral is becoming bleached, which means it is losing its vibrant colors and health. This is a sign that the reef is not doing well. Additionally, the number of fish living in the reef is decreasing, which can affect the entire ecosystem. At the same time, there is an overgrowth of algae, which can smother the coral and disrupt the balance of life in the reef. Local fishing communities depend on the reef for their livelihoods, as it provides them with food and supports their way of life.
